Cebu Pacific is celebrating its 16th year of
operations with a 90% off systemwide anniversary sale from 8-9
March or until seats last. The promotion is for travel from 1
August 2012 to 31 March 2013.
“CEB started its operations in March 8, 1996,
with daily flights to Cebu and Davao. Our network has expanded
significantly since then, but our commitment remains the same: to
fly our passengers on the lowest fares and boost tourism and trade
in the destinations we operate to,” said CEB VP for Marketing and
Distribution Candice Iyog. “We encourage guests to take
advantage of this 90% off anniversary seat sale to 19
international and 33 domestic destinations from our Manila, Clark,
Cebu and Davao hubs. We are also all set to launch our maiden
Manila-Hanoi, Manila-Xiamen, Cebu-Kalibo and Kalibo-Hong Kong
flights this March and April.”

CEB
currently operates 10 Airbus A319, 20 Airbus A320 and 8 ATR-72 500
aircraft. Its fleet of 38 aircraft – with an average age of 3.6
years – is one of the most modern aircraft fleets in the world.
Between 2012 and 2021, Cebu Pacific will take delivery of 22 more
Airbus A320 and 30 Airbus A321neo aircraft orders, and 2 Airbus
A320 aircraft on operating lease agreements.
